Florida decor ideas typically involve bright colors, natural materials, and coastal themes that can help you achieve a light and breezy feel in your home. Here are some creative tips to get started:Embrace Bright ColorsOne of the most effective Florida decor ideas is to use a palette of bright and cheerful colors. Shades of coral, turquoise, sunny yellow, and lush green can bring an uplifting energy to your living spaces. Consider painting walls in these colors or incorporating them through accent pieces such as cushions, rugs, and artwork.Incorporate Natural TexturesUsing natural materials is essential for achieving that laid-back Florida vibe. Opt for furniture made from rattan, wicker, or reclaimed wood for a casual yet stylish look. Textiles should reflect the outdoor environment, so consider using cotton or linen for curtains and upholstery to keep your space feeling airy and fresh.Coastal Themes and AccessoriesTo truly capture the essence of Florida, add coastal-themed decor elements. Think about incorporating seashells, coral, and nautical motifs in your accessories. Wall art featuring ocean scenes, beach photography, or even driftwood sculptures can serve as beautiful focal points in your home.Bring the Outdoors InFlorida's climate encourages indoor-outdoor living. Use large windows or sliding glass doors to blur the line between your living space and the outdoors. Consider adding indoor plants like palms or succulents to enhance the tropical feel. A sunroom or a well-decorated patio can extend your living space and offer a perfect spot for relaxation.Use Multi-Functional FurnitureIn small spaces, consider multi-functional furniture that maximizes utility without compromising style. Look for ottomans with storage, a coffee table that can double as a dining table, or a fold-out desk that maintains your decor aesthetic while providing flexibility.Light and Airy FabricsOpt for light fabrics that allow for airflow and natural light. Sheer curtains can let in sunshine while providing a sense of privacy.
